RORA, ROBO1, CFH and HTRA1 Gene Polymorphisms and Neovascular Age-Related Macular Degeneration in a Turkish Cohort Study

The aim of this study is to investigate whether there are any associations between rs8034864 (RORA), rs1387665 (ROBO1), rs1329424 (CFH), rs3793917 (HTRA1) polymorphisms and Neovascular Age Related Macular Degeneration (nAMD). We conducted a case-control study of the related polymorphisms in Turkish patients. We compared genotype and allele frequencies of 125 patients diagnosed nAMD and 108 healthy controls in terms of related polymorphisms. Genotyping was performed with Real-time Polymerase Chain Reaction. We found significant association between rs1329424 (CFH), rs3793917 (HTRA1) polymorphisms and
nAMD. There were significant differences between cases and controls in terms of genotype and allele frequencies of rs1329424 (CFH), rs3793917 (HTRA1) (P=0,0017, OR= 1,82; P0,0001, OR=3,26; respectively). On contrary to these findings, there were no significant associations between rs8034864 (RORA), rs1387665 (ROBO1) polymorphisms and nAMD. There were no significant differences between cases and controls in terms of genotype and allele frequencies of rs8034864 (RORA) and rs1387665 (ROBO1) (P=0,110995, OR= 0,72; P=0,236724, OR= 1,25; respectively). Significant association was verified between rs1329424 (CFH), rs3793917 (HTRA1) polymorphisms and nAMD in our study group as reported in literature before. However, further studies in a larger sample are needed for providing information about the rs8034864 (RORA), rs1387665 (ROBO1) polymorphisms and nAMD.
